Abstract
This paper uses the parameter extraction model of the transmission terahertz time-domain spectroscopy technology to theoretically simulate the terahertz time-domain signal of the sample, and then simulates and analyzes the Fabry-Perot effect. The simulated sample signal is very close to the measured sample signal. Through simulation, the influence of thickness, refractive index, and extinction coefficient on the terahertz time-domain signal is analyzed. Finally, suggestions for sample detection and signal processing of terahertz time-domain spectroscopy are put forward.
